Sectional doors are built from separate panels, so a damaged one can often be swapped out. It works best when the door is a current model, the profile is still made, and the damage is limited to one or two sections.
Check the rest of the door at the same time. A car impact hard enough to damage a panel usually bends a track or a hinge as well.
This is the honest catch. A new panel on a door that has been in Gold Coast sun for eight years will not match. Colorbond fades, and a fresh section next to weathered ones is visible.
For a door at the back of a property that may not matter at all. On a street frontage it often does, and that's the point where replacing the whole door starts to make sense. Worth deciding deliberately rather than being surprised afterwards.
Panels that have corroded through rather than been hit are a different judgement. Rust that has started at the bottom edge of one panel has usually started on the others too — replacing one buys a year, not a decade.

Where this job typically sits. Access is usually a bigger cost driver than size.
| Job | Indicative price | What moves it |
|---|---|---|
| Service call / diagnosis | $90 – $180 | Callout and assessment. Usually credited against the repair if you go ahead. |
| Torsion spring replacement | $250 – $600 | Priced per spring. Doors with two springs are normally done as a pair. |
| Cable replacement | $150 – $350 | Often done alongside springs — the two wear together. |
| Motor / opener repair | $150 – $450 | Boards, capacitors and gear sets. Cheaper than replacing the unit where the parts exist. |
| New motor / opener supplied and fitted | $450 – $1,200 | Depends on horsepower, drive type and whether Wi-Fi control is wanted. |
| Roller door repair | $180 – $600 | Curtain, drum, spring or guide work on a roller door. |
| Off-track / re-alignment | $150 – $400 | Common after something clips the door. Check the panels before assuming it's just tracks. |
| Panel or section replacement | $300 – $900+ | Per panel, and colour-matching an older door is the variable. |
| Remote or keypad replacement | $60 – $220 | Coding a new remote is often a five-minute job. |
| Full door replacement (existing opening) | $1,400 – $4,000+ | Sectional, roller or tilt, plus wind classification for the site. |
Prices are indicative only. What a job costs depends on the door type, the part, and whether it can be repaired or has to be replaced. You get a firm price before any work starts.
